[wp-trac] [WordPress Trac] #63427: User roles property should always be an array, but they sometimes become an object in localized data

WordPress Trac noreply at wordpress.org
Sat Nov 1 14:31:36 UTC 2025


#63427: User roles property should always be an array, but they sometimes become an
object in localized data
-------------------------------------------------+-------------------------
 Reporter:  haruncpi                             |       Owner:
                                                 |  SergeyBiryukov
     Type:  defect (bug)                         |      Status:  reviewing
 Priority:  normal                               |   Milestone:  6.9
Component:  Users                                |     Version:  2.0
 Severity:  normal                               |  Resolution:
 Keywords:  has-patch has-test-info has-unit-    |     Focuses:
  tests                                          |
-------------------------------------------------+-------------------------

Comment (by haruncpi):

 I have merged the latest changes from `WordPress:trunk into` my PR branch.
 I ran the `tests/phpunit/tests/user.php` suite, and all tests passed
 successfully.
 Additionally, the `test_user_roles_property_is_sequential_array` test ran
 without any failures.

 Replying to [comment:15 wildworks]:
 > @haruncpi @SirLouen Can you rebase the pull request on top of the trunk
 branch to run CI and ensure that the tests don't fail?

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/63427#comment:16>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list